Aged rum, lime, orgeat, orange curaçao. Donn Beach territory contested by Trader Vic. The drink that launched mid-century tiki.
Typical way it's made: 1 oz white rum, 1 oz dark rum, 1 oz lime juice, 0.5 oz triple sec, 0.5 oz orgeat
Victor 'Trader Vic' Bergeron mixed the first one at his Oakland restaurant in 1944 around a 17-year Jamaican rum, lime, orange curaçao, and orgeat. Tahitian friends tasted it and, as Vic told it, cried 'Maita'i roa ae': out of this world. Donn Beach claimed the drink too, and the two tiki giants argued the point for decades.
Did you know
Postwar demand for the Mai Tai drank the world's supply of its original spirit, Wray & Nephew 17-year Jamaican rum, nearly dry, forcing Trader Vic to rebuild the spec around other rums.
